The level of teaching and learning at Doane requires that students have certain basic skills. All students must demonstrate competencies in each of the following areas during their first year at Doane by one of the methods listed below. (Individual academic majors may require particular competencies.)
Basic Mathematical Skills
All students must demonstrate adequate basic computational skills before enrolling in any mathematics course numbered 100 or above. This requirement may be met in any of five ways:
- by attaining an ACT math score of 19 or higher,
- by attaining an SAT math score of 530 or higher,
- by passing Doane’s Math Placement Test,
- by completing DLC 090 or DSS 090 (Crete campus only) with a grade of C- or higher, or
- by transferring credits that are equivalent to DLC 090 /DSS 090 or college-level mathematics.
Basic Reading/Writing Skills
Reading/Writing skills are evaluated during the enrollment/advising process. This requirement may be met in any of four ways:
- ACT of 19 in English and Reading sections
- SAT score of 450 or higher in the Reading subsection
- Submit official transcripts showing completed college coursework in English with a grade of a C or higher
- ACCUPLACER Score of 250 or higher on the Reading Test
- Take the Nelson Denny Reading Test during enrollment days and score above 42% for all sections (Note: this is not an average of 42%, but each section must be above 42%).
If a student does not meet these requirements, they will be placed in DSS 110 or DLC 110 , which are University Foundation courses (which count towards general graduation requirements).
